Hernando de Soto was a Spanish explorer looking for gold, silver, and other riches in the Americas. He led expeditions with the intention of acquiring wealth and expanding Spanish territory.

Who was the Spanish explorer came to Georgia looking for gold?

Hernando de Soto was the Spanish explorer who came to Georgia looking for gold in the 16th century. His expedition was part of the broader Spanish exploration of the southeastern United States.
